NATIONAL ANTHEM CEREMONY INDIA v NEW ZEALAND - Cricket World Cup 2023
  • 5 months ago
Video Clip of The National Anthem : Semi Final 1 : India vs New Zealand at Wankhede Stadium, Mumbai.
Recommended